Output 76848328c1c362f5c61779d99b25f29c603eece0c89f9df26cdf50a8e2079f3b:3

value
2952825
script pubkey
OP_0 OP_PUSHBYTES_20 255d759cd947a77beecb995d2ae880e16e2bff62
address
bc1qy4wht8xeg7nhhmktn9wj46yqu9hzhlmzwa2szz
transaction
76848328c1c362f5c61779d99b25f29c603eece0c89f9df26cdf50a8e2079f3b
confirmations
181391
spent
true